MOUNT PLEASANT, NY — A fiery crash on the Sprain has left one person dead.
The New York State Police say that on Tuesday, around 6:30 p.m., troopers from Hawthorne were dispatched to the area of mile marker 10.4, on the southbound Sprain Brook Parkway, in the town of Mount Pleasant, after receiving a report of a two-car vehicle collision involving a vehicle fire.
Investigators say a 2023 Toyota, driven by 31-year-old Michael C. Dilello, of East Fishkill, was traveling south in the left lane when it was sideswiped by a 2025 Honda traveling in the center lane.
State police say that after the collision, the Honda left the roadway, entered the center grass median, and hit a support pillar of the Grasslands Road overpass before becoming engulfed in flames.
Dilello was not injured and was released. Police say the identity of the Honda driver is being withheld pending autopsy.
The investigation is ongoing, according to state police.
